Two Indian American Actors Join the Cast of the Second Season of Disney+ Series ‘Goosebumps’

  • Arjun Athalye will star as Sameer, while Sakina Jaffrey will play Ramona, described as “a mysterious woman.”

Sakina Jaffrey and Arjun Athalye are joining the recurring cast of the second season of the Disney+ series “Goosebumps.” The two Indian American actors are joined by Eloise Payet, Christopher Paul Richards, Kyra Tantao, and Stony Blyden. They will appear alongside previously announced cast members David Schwimmer, Ana Ortiz, Sam McCarthy, Jayden Bartels, Elijah Cooper, Galilea La Salvia, and Francesca Noel. Variety had previously reported that the series “would be going the anthology series route in Season 2, meaning it will feature an entirely new cast and storyline than the first season.”

Athalye will star as Sameer, described as one of the “four teenagers who mysteriously vanished in, becoming a central secret to the present-day characters,” according to Variety. Jaffrey will play Ramona, described only as “a mysterious woman,” the entertainment portal added. 

According to the official description for Season 2, “the new story begins with Devin (McCarthy) and Cece (Bartels), fraternal twins adjusting to life with their recently divorced dad, Anthony (Schwimmer). When the duo discovers a threat stirring, they quickly realize that dark secrets are among them, triggering a chain of events that unravel a profound mystery. As they delve into the unknown, Devin, Cece and their friends — Alex (Noel), CJ (Cooper) and Frankie (La Salvia) — find themselves entangled in the chilling tale of four teenagers who mysteriously vanished in 1994.”

Jaffer joined the Showtime drama “Billions,” as a series regular for Season 6. The “House of Cards” played Daevisha “Dave” Mahar, “a dogged defense attorney at a white-shoe firm. She “goes up against New York Attorney General Chuck Rhoades (Paul Giamatti) on a case and sways him to draft her into his cause,” according to a Deadline report.

The Canada-born Athalye rose to fame after being cast as Jai Malya on Nickelodeon’s rebooted “Are You Afraid of the Dark?” series. This exposure led to him garnering a dedicated fan base on social media. He was a guest lead on Disney Plus’s “Just Beyond” in 2021. He studied musical theater in high school. He also played timpani with the New Jersey Symphony Youth Orchestra.
